Job Summary ConocoPhillips is an independent exploration and production (E&P) company headquartered in Houston, Texas. We explore for, produce, transport and market crude oil, bitumen, natural gas, natural gas liquids and liquefied natural gas on a worldwide basis. As of Dec. 31, 2023, we had operations and activities in 13 countries.
We manage our operations through six operating segments defined by geographic area: Lower 48; Europe, Middle East and North Africa; Asia Pacific; Alaska; Canada; and Other International. ConocoPhillips' operating segments include a strong base of legacy production, multiple ongoing development programs that offer low cost of supply and low-carbon intensity, along with focused exploration opportunities.
The company embraces its role in responsibly accessing, developing and producing oil and natural gas to help meet the world's energy needs, today and throughout the energy transition. ConocoPhillips has the technical capability to operate globally while maintaining a relentless focus on safety and environmental stewardship.
ConocoPhillips common stock is listed on the New York Stock Exchange under the ticker symbol "COP."
